Two superlatives await visitors to the Deutsches Museum (German Museum): with over 300,000 individual figures, it is the largest museum of its kind in the world - and more than 19,000 of them are in the world's largest flat-figure diorama. It shows the events of Conrad Day 1553, when Kulmbach was almost completely destroyed by enemy troops.150 dioramas bring history(s) to life in miniature. Visitors can admire ancient hunts and meet Romans, Teutons, knights and lansquenets. They can witness the hustle and bustle of Frederician and Napoleonic battles, discover foreign continents, meet characters from the world of fairy tales or be enchanted by scenes from famous paintings.
